Details

The Dytran model 1061C is a piezoelectric charge mode force sensor, designed to measure both compressive and tensile forces from 10 to 25,000 lbf over a wide frequency range. Offered with a sensitivity of 9 pC/lbf, this dynamic force sensor can measure up to 500 lbs full scale in tension mode, with reliable high temperature operation to +500°F (+260°C).

Design of the model 1061C features a quartz sensing element, operating in compression mode and packaged in a rugged stainless steel housing, for an overall weight of 420 grams. Units incorporate a 10-32 radial connector and a series of 3/8-16 tapped holes, located at the top and bottom of the sensor housing, for ease of mounting.

Supplied Accessories: (2) model 6232 mounting studs (3/8-24)
